Understanding The Foundation Of Case Management Software

In the fast-paced world of business and healthcare, the need for efficient case management solutions has become increasingly apparent Case management software offers organizations a streamlined approach to handling complex cases, improving productivity, and ultimately delivering better outcomes for their clients But what exactly is case management software based on? Let’s delve into the foundation of this essential tool and explore the key elements that make it so effective.

At its core, case management software is designed to facilitate the management of cases through a structured process Whether it’s tracking a patient’s progress in healthcare, managing legal cases in a law firm, or handling customer complaints in a call center, this software provides a centralized platform for organizing and monitoring information related to each case.

One of the key foundations of case management software is its ability to create a digital record of each case This record serves as a centralized repository for all relevant information, including client details, case history, communication logs, and any associated documents By storing this information in a digital format, organizations can easily access and update it in real-time, ensuring that all stakeholders have the most current data at their fingertips.

Furthermore, case management software is based on the concept of workflow automation By defining specific steps and tasks within the software, organizations can streamline their processes and ensure that each case is handled efficiently and consistently Automated alerts and notifications can also be set up to remind users of important deadlines or required actions, reducing the risk of oversights and delays.

Another key component of case management software is its integration capabilities Whether it’s linking with existing systems within an organization or connecting with external databases and applications, this software is designed to work seamlessly with other tools to provide a comprehensive solution Integration allows for the sharing of data across different platforms, minimizing duplication of effort and ensuring a more cohesive approach to case management.

Moreover, case management software is built on a foundation of customization Organizations can tailor the software to meet their specific needs and requirements, from creating custom fields and workflows to designing personalized dashboards and reports This flexibility ensures that the software can adapt to evolving business processes and support the unique workflows of each organization.

Given the sensitive nature of the information stored within the software, robust security measures are put in place to protect data from unauthorized access or breaches Encryption, user authentication, and role-based access controls are just a few of the security features that help safeguard sensitive information and ensure compliance with data protection regulations.

In addition, case management software is typically cloud-based, which offers several advantages Cloud-based solutions eliminate the need for costly hardware installations and maintenance, making them more cost-effective and scalable for organizations of all sizes Cloud deployment also enables remote access to the software, allowing users to collaborate on cases from anywhere with an internet connection.

Collaboration is another key pillar of case management software By providing a central platform for users to communicate and collaborate on cases, this software fosters teamwork and ensures that all stakeholders are on the same page Real-time updates and shared access to case information enable faster decision-making and more effective problem-solving.
